Comment utiliser Ruby Logger dans Rails ?

La classe Logger, comme son nom l'indique, fournit une fonctionnalité de journalisation pour noter les points importants que vous pouvez utiliser pour générer différents types de messages.
The messages can be of different severities aka levels;

NIVEAU RÉSUMÉ
INCONNU Les messages inconnus sont des messages inattendus ou aléatoires et ils doivent toujours être enregistrés.
FATAL Une erreur qui n'a pas été gérée et qui pourrait entraîner le crash du programme
ERREUR Une erreur qui peut être gérée
AVERTIR Un avertissement
INFO Informations génériques sur l'utilisation du code en cours d'exécution
DÉBOGUER Informations déduites lors du débogage

L'ordre est le suivant :
debug < info < warn < erreur < fatal < inconnu

They work as;
Dans mode de fabrication, you can set-up your Logger to output the messages which are either INFO messages or of the WARN level.
While in Mode de développement, you would want to keep a tab on the program’s state and its status and therefore, you can set the Logger to the DEBUG level.

The interface is normally used as follows;

ruby logger 3

Vous avez également la possibilité de définir une date d'expiration pour le fichier journal. Par exemple, je souhaite conserver les journaux uniquement pour le mois en cours. Dans ce cas, je procéderai comme suit :

ruby logger

Et au niveau applicatif,

Ruby logger 2

Happy logging !

Signing out,

Niyanta Zamindar
Développeur Ruby on Rails 

Abonnez-vous pour les dernières mises à jour

Articles Similaires

À propos de l'auteur du message

Laissez un commentaire

Votre adresse de messagerie ne sera pas publiée. Les champs obligatoires sont indiqués avec *

fr_FRFrench